VTV.vn - irst off, Vietnam has welcomed a new state leader. Tran Dai Quang has officially become the new State President of Vietnam, with 91% of votes today (April 2nd).

On the occasion, the newly-elected State President made a speech at the swearing-in ceremony. The new State President thanked the National Assembly for electing him as State leader and extended best wishes to him. He also expressed sincere thanks to former State President Truong Tan Sang and his predecessors who have made great contributions to national construction and development and wholeheartedly served the country and the people.

Born in 1956, State President Tran Dai Quang was a deputy in the 13th National Assembly and holds a law professorship. He was Director of the Security Consultation Department, Deputy Director and Director of the Security Department, Deputy Minister of Public Security, member of the 10th, 11th, and 12th Party Central Committee, member of the politburo of the 11th Party Central Committee, and Minister of Public Security.
